Python provides several functions and utilities for code introspection. Python is a powerful, modern programming language used by many famous organisations such as youtube and nasa. Practical python for the gis analyst authors andor instructors. This book presents an introduction to gui programming in python. Well laid out and everything is easily explained and understood. Python basics glossary argument a piece of information that is required by a function so that it can perform its task. All programs in this page are tested and should work on almost all python3 compilers. Codecademy is the easiest way to learn how to code. While javascript is not essential for this website, your interaction with the content will be limited. Here you will find a short summary of each chapter of the book. I have to print to pdf a discrete amount of python script.
Code introspection learn python free interactive python. Python computer program language, scripting languages. Its design philosophy emphasizes code readability, and its syntax allows programmers to express concepts in fewer lines of code than would be possible in languages such as c. In this book, you will use that hardwon knowledge to have some fun making some little applications while reenforcing your knowledge and learning a few more tricks. Datacamp offers interactive r, python, sheets, sql and shell courses. Here youll find stepbystep instructions for our coding projects, which will teach you how to create games, animations and more with code. Learn to code with python introduces you to the world of writing computer programs without drowning you in confusing jargon or theory that make getting started harder than it should be.
All on topics in data science, statistics and machine learning. Often the most important one is the help function, since you can use it to find what other functions do. A tamagotchi game programs, information, and people. In python, variables can be grouped together under one name. In any oop language, there are many different data types. We use your linkedin profile and activity data to personalize ads and to show you more relevant ads. Python 3 comes with some great, readybuilt modules some of which we have already. Contribute to charmygargpython development by creating an account on github. Pythons combination of exceptional power and simplicity has made it one of the worlds fastest growing programming languages. Learn python, a powerful language used by sites like youtube and dropbox. Lets pull all these mechanics together in a slightly more interesting way than we got with the point class. The book the book consists of a series of exercises and documentation developed to test a students understanding of python and also develop their problem solving skills. The best way to learn any programming language is by practicing examples on your own. Get familiar with python, one of the most widelyused and widelytaught programming languages in senior schools, universities and businesses, and learn to code from the ground up.
I installed my version a while back and dont need to use it too often and therefore am not sure whether the above download is what i have it shouldnt matter too much, but if you have such concerns, then you can download the version i. Onecanrefertoaprogramasapieceofsoftware as if it were a tangible object, but software is. Filled with practical examples and stepbystep lessons using the easyonthebrain python language, this book will get you programming in no time. The first line with less indentation is outside of the block. Python is a widely used generalpurpose, highlevel programming language. The c structure of the objects used to describe code objects. Jun, 20 that is why i have developed a book of resources to teach python programming with minecraft pi. Python programming for the absolute beginner edition 3 by. Cambridge university press, oct 25, 2012 juvenile nonfiction 83 pages. Answers and full source code are on the resources page books at this level are intended for young coders that have enjoyed level 1 books and want to continue their coding adventure at a slightly higher level.
Apr 18, 20 a unique series that provides a framework for teaching coding skills. The official home of the python programming language. Python programming basics with examples 20170404 20190221 comments12 python is a popular and a powerful scripting language that can do everything, you can perform web scraping, networking tools, scientific tools, raspberry pi programming. Book 2 continues seamlessly on from python basics, offering full support and progressive tasks for students who have some basic programming experience and are ready to move on to slightly more challenging material. No braces to mark blocks of code in python use consistent indentation instead. Computers and coding have not been around for a long time but they have sure packed in. Code club is a voluntary initiative, founded in 2012. Coding club python basics level 1 coding club, level 1. There is also a list of resources in other languages which might be. This lively book is an introduction to the world of coding and to python 3 a fantastic language to. Please do not edit or create help pages in other wikis than moinmaster see helpcontents, because the pages from moinmaster will overwrite any other changes on wiki engine.
Simplified python programming for bitcoin and blockchainkey featuresbuild bitcoin applications in python with the help of simple examplesmine bitcoins, program bitcoinenabled apis and transaction graphs, and build trading botsanalyze bitcoin transactions and produce visualizations using python data analysis. Code club is a global network of free coding clubs. You are advised to take references of these examples and try them on your own. Register your club today to access great benefits, including downloadable resources such as certificates and posters. Topics include the basics of window layout, widget. Developed by computer science instructors, books in the for the absolute beginner series teach the principles of programming through simple game creation. Code introspection is the ability to examine classes, functions and keywords to know what they are, what they do and what they know. Coding club level 1 python basics parameter computer. Python programming for the absolute beginner edition 3. In python, number data types are used to store numeric values.
These scripts start very easy for absolute beginners, and build upon knowledge. A unique series that provides a framework for teaching coding skills. Python programming basics with examples like geeks. Being an electronics engineer, it was difficult to enter the field of programming and my life would have been completely different without coding ninjas support. You will learn how to program and customise a simple calculator and. The fields of this type are subject to change at any time. Coding club python basics level 1 by chris roffey waterstones. The goal of the course is to introduce students to python version 3. Its design philosophy emphasizes code readability, and its syntax allows programmers to express concepts in. Tuples make sense for small collections of data, e. This makes writing short programs very fast and you can produce almost anything you can imagine. If you get stuck, you can download the complete source code from the same page.
The import statement we are going to use a function from python s random module so we need to import it. The answers to the challenges can be found on the resources page. If you are new to programming with python and are looking for a solid introduction, this is the book for you. Young programmers will learn how to code and customise several fun applications including their own magic8ball and an etch a sketch game. It is a place which teaches you to find a solution rather than knowing a solution and builds up a great foundation for any student. Learn the fundamentals of programming to build web apps and manipulate data. Now, theres a comprehensive, handson introduction to python from the deitels, leading corporate trainers and authors of the best selling how to program books. Python abbreviations, contextmanager, variables, with by alfe 2 years ago create calendars on pdf with a few lines. Everyday low prices and free delivery on eligible orders. Coding club level 1 python basics free download as pdf file. Python basics you learned the fundamentals of programming using python 3. To download python for windows and osx, and for documentation see. Its interactive, fun, and you can do it with your friends. This lively book is an introduction to the world of coding and to python 3 a fantastic language to start coding with.
The code should be included as text, rather than image, as it must be checked by an antiplagiarism mechanism i do not have to take care of this, it is just requested that the pdf is not made from an image, thats all. There are also a lot of interesting ways to put userdefined classes to use that dont involve data from the internet. Like all of the deitels how to program books, python how to program features the deitels. Python context, exception, guard, manager by steven daprano 2 years ago, revision 2 variable abbreviations. The initiative aims to provide opportunities for children aged 9 to to develop coding skills through free afterschool clubs. Python basics, level 1 coding club coding club, level 1 bought this for my son 15 he soon got through it and now is on book 2. If you find any errors on the help pages, please describe them on helperrata. The nice people at mojang had just given me the perfect platform to teach students programming. When i first heard that minecraft would be released for the raspberry pi i punched the air.
Before getting started, you may want to find out which ides and text editors are tailored to make python editing easy, browse the list of introductory books, or look at code samples that you might find helpful there is a list of tutorials suitable for experienced programmers on the beginnersguidetutorials page. This code has to be in a form that the computer can understand. As of november 2015, over 3,800 schools and other public venues established a code club, regularly attended by an estimated 44,000 young people across the uk. There are different ways to do this, and one is to use tuples. Python calendar, fitz, mupdf, pdf, pymupdf by jorj x. Coding club python basics level 1 by chris roffey, 9781107658554, available at book depository with free delivery worldwide. Learn from a team of expert teachers in the comfort of your browser with video lessons and fun coding challenges and projects. It will show how to install python and use the spyder ide. Introduction to gis modeling and python up lesson 3. There are four different numerical types in python. Python basicspb home coding club learn to program well. One where students are encouraged to explore ideas in a familiar environment, while seeing the tangible results of their. Oct 25, 2012 buy coding club python basics level 1 coding club, level 1 spi by roffey, chris isbn.
1167 980 1271 466 1404 45 359 327 389 1162 1408 145 1134 131 815 808 1503 404 699 200 29 1254 225 1385 227 452 1376 469 491 205 1319 1294 762